Masonry Waterproofing in Alpharetta, GA
Masonry waterproofing services focus on protecting the structural integrity of brick, stone, and concrete surfaces from water intrusion and damage. This service is commonly requested for projects such as foundation walls, retaining walls, basement exteriors, and chimneys. Property owners typically want to understand how waterproofing can prevent issues like cracking, efflorescence, mold growth, and water seepage that can compromise the durability and safety of their property.
Before requesting masonry waterproofing, property owners often seek information about the types of waterproofing methods available, including sealants, coatings, or membrane applications. It’s also important to consider the condition of existing masonry surfaces and whether repairs are needed beforehand. Understanding the scope of work, potential benefits, and maintenance requirements can help homeowners make informed decisions about protecting their property from water-related damage.

Masonry Waterproofing Questions
What is masonry waterproofing? Masonry waterproofing involves applying protective materials to brick, stone, or concrete surfaces to prevent water from penetrating the structure.
Why is waterproofing important for masonry? It helps prevent water damage, such as cracking, spalling, and mold growth, which can compromise the integrity of the building.
What types of projects typically require masonry waterproofing? Common projects include foundation walls, retaining walls, basement exteriors, and decorative stone facades prone to moisture exposure.
How does masonry waterproofing work? It creates a barrier that blocks water entry while allowing vapor to escape, helping to keep interiors dry and protect the masonry surfaces.
